Cost of independent living in Seward County, NE

The average cost of senior living in Seward County is 3,777 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Rising City, NE with an average of 2,573 per month.

What is independent living?

Independent living offers a stress-free lifestyle for older adults. Independent living communities don’t provide personal care or supervision, but do offer generally healthy adults opportunities for socialization and hassle-free living. Independent living services often include:

  • Nutritious meals and snacks
  • Housekeeping
  • Laundry
  • Home maintenance and repairs
  • Social activities and outings
